Hey小伙伴们,今天来聊聊一个超实用的话题——如何让HTML加载音频文件的速度飞起来!是不是经常在网页上听到那令人抓狂的“加载中”?别急,我来教你几招,让你的网页音乐播放体验更上一层楼。
我们要明白,音频文件的加载速度受很多因素影响,比如文件大小、网络速度、服务器响应时间等,别担心,我们可以通过一些技巧来优化这个过程。
1、选择正确的音频格式:不同的音频格式压缩率不同,文件大小也不同,MP3和AAC是比较常见的选择,它们在音质和文件大小之间取得了很好的平衡,如果你的目标用户群体对音质要求不是特别高,也可以考虑使用更小的文件格式,比如OGG。
2、压缩音频文件:使用音频编辑软件对音频文件进行压缩,可以在保持音质的同时减少文件大小,这样,文件加载起来就会更快,记得,压缩时不要过度,否则音质会受损。
3、使用CDN服务分发网络(CDN)可以将你的音频文件存储在全球多个服务器上,这样用户就可以从离他们最近的服务器下载音频文件,大大减少加载时间,这对于全球用户来说尤其有用。
4、预加载音频文件:在用户访问网页时,可以预先加载音频文件,这样,当用户点击播放按钮时,音频文件已经准备好了,可以立即播放,要注意不要预加载太多文件,否则可能会影响页面的加载速度。
5、使用Web Audio API:这是一种更高级的技术,可以让你在浏览器中处理音频文件,比如调整音量、速度等,通过这种方式,你可以在不下载完整音频文件的情况下播放音频,从而提高加载速度。
6、优化服务器设置:确保你的服务器可以快速响应音频文件的请求,这可能需要调整服务器的缓存设置,或者使用更快的硬盘存储音频文件。
7、使用媒体服务器:媒体服务器专门用于处理媒体文件的请求,它们可以更高效地处理音频文件的加载和传输。
8、适应性流媒体技术:这是一种动态调整音频质量的技术,根据用户的网络速度和设备性能来提供最合适的音频质量,这样,即使在网络条件不佳的情况下,用户也能获得较好的播放体验。
9、减少HTTP请求:每个音频文件的加载都会产生一个HTTP请求,这会增加服务器的负担,也会影响加载速度,如果可能的话,尝试将多个音频文件合并成一个文件,或者使用雪碧图技术。
10、测试和优化:使用网站性能测试工具,比如Google PageSpeed Insights,来检测你的音频文件加载速度,并根据测试结果进行优化。
通过这些方法,你可以显著提高音频文件的加载速度,提升用户体验,用户体验是王道,一个流畅的音频播放体验可以让用户在你的网站上停留更长时间,不要小看这些小技巧,它们可能会给你带来意想不到的效果哦!
好啦,今天的分享就到这里,希望这些技巧能帮助你优化网页上的音频播放体验,如果你有任何问题或者想要分享你的经验,欢迎在评论区交流哦!我们下次见!



还没有评论,来说两句吧...